Facts about The Path

✔️

When was The Path released?


The Path is first released on August 01, 2012 as part of Ghost Mice's album "All We Got Is Each Other" which includes 9 tracks in total. This song is the 3rd track on this album.
✔️

Which genre is The Path?


The Path falls under the genre Alternative.
✔️

How long is the song The Path?


The Path song length is 2 minutes and 19 seconds.
